Generator control panels and locations (air-cooled and liquid-cooled)
Use this guide to identify which controller your Generac home standby generator uses and where the control panel is located on the unit. Sections are grouped by air-cooled and liquid-cooled models. Controller type and placement can vary by model family, kW rating, and production year. Always confirm with your unit’s data label and user manual. To find manuals, visit the product lookup page. Air-cooled standby generators
Guardian (Evolution 1.0)
Most Guardian series models from approximately 2013–2017 use the Evolution 1.0 controller. The controller panel is mounted under the lid at the front of the enclosure. For an overview, see What is the Evolution controller?
Location: under lid, front panel (exterior access).
Guardian (Evolution 2.0)
Most Guardian series models from approximately 2017–present use the Evolution 2.0 controller. For feature and menu details, see Evolution 2.0 controller menu map and Evolution controller overview.
Location: under lid, front panel (exterior access).
Next Gen air-cooled (Power Zone 200)
Next Generation air-cooled models use the Power Zone 200 controller (replaces Evolution 2.0 on Next Gen Guardian). See What’s new about the Next Generation standby generator? and What is the Power Zone 200 controller?
Location: under lid, front panel (keypad without display).
Nexus and Pre-Nexus
Air-cooled home standby models manufactured circa 2010–2013 typically use the Nexus controller; models before ~2010 are considered Pre-Nexus. See The Nexus and Pre-Nexus Control Panels and Nexus controller menu map.
Location: under lid, front panel.
PowerPact 7.5 kW (PowerPact/CorePower controller)
The 7.5 kW PowerPact uses a simplified controller (no LCD) with basic buttons and indicators. For details, see Operating the Controller on the 7.5 kW PowerPact and What is the PowerPact or Core Power Control Panel?
Location: behind the small front access door.
Liquid-cooled standby generators
XG Series — Power Zone 410 controller
All XG series liquid-cooled generators use the Power Zone 410 controller. The controller is located on the exterior of the unit. For an overview, see What is the Power Zone 410 controller?

RA Diesel Series — Power Zone 410 controller
RA series diesel models use the Power Zone 410 controller. The controller is located inside the generator behind the access door of the unit. Only the circuit breaker is behind the exterior flip up cover. This is in contrast to the RD series that uses the same flip up cover. For an overview, see What is the Power Zone 410 controller?
RD Diesel Series — Evolution controller
RD Diesel series models use the Evolution controller. The controller is located on the exterior of the unit. For an overview, see What is the Evolution controller?
RG Series (80 kW and smaller) — Evolution controller
On RG series units rated 80 kW and smaller, the Evolution controller is on the outside of the unit. For an overview, see What is the Evolution controller?

RG Series (100 kW only) — Evolution controller
On RG series units rated 100 kW only, the Evolution controller is located inside the generator behind the access door of the unit. For an overview, see What is the Evolution controller?

QT Series — Nexus controller
On QT series generators, the Nexus controller is located inside the unit. See The Nexus and Pre-Nexus Control Panels and Nexus controller menu map.
